linux软件001

关于为Jetbrains家开发工具建立快捷方式(linux)的两种方法

## 前言 考虑到jetbrains给出的安装包都是脚本命令语言,即后缀名为sh的文件,每一次打开都要使用Terminal打开,为了方便的打开,我们这里来创建一下快捷方式。 ### 方法一 这是最为传统的方式,即书写一个desktop的文件,讲路径与图标写进去,授予其执行权限来实现,下面是实现方法。 ......
开发工具 Jetbrains 方式 工具 方法

linux内核等待队列详解

https://www.cnblogs.com/xinghuo123/p/13347964.html 等待队列用于使得进程等待某一特定事件的发生,无需频繁的轮询,进程在等待周期中睡眠,当时间发生后由内核自动唤醒。 1 数据结构 1.1 等待队列头 等待队列结构如下,因为每个等待队列都可以再中断时被修 ......
队列 内核 linux

Linux 主机磁盘繁忙度监控实战shell脚本

iostat 是一个常用的工具,可以提供关于磁盘活动的详细统计信息。通过运行命令 iostat -x 1 可以实时监测磁盘的使用情况,其中 %util 列就表示磁盘的繁忙度,数值越高表示磁盘越繁忙。 ......
磁盘 脚本 实战 主机 Linux

linux定时任务的设置

为当前用户创建cron服务 1. 键入 crontab -e 编辑crontab服务文件 例如 文件内容如下: */2 * * * * /bin/sh /home/admin/jiaoben/buy/deleteFile.sh 保存文件并并退出 */2 * * * * /bin/sh /home/a ......
任务 linux

linux 分配git用户名和密码

touch .git-credentials 然后用代码编辑工具打开刚才的文件,编辑如下: https://你的用户名:你的密码@github.com 这一步你要注意一下,如果你是dsdn的账号,注意一下后缀,应该是https://你的用户名:你的密码@code.csdn.net,这个根据情况而定 ......
用户名 密码 用户 linux git

Linux 密码密文格式/etc/shadow

## 一、密码密文格式 /etc/shadow ![image](https://img2023.cnblogs.com/blog/597729/202309/597729-20230901104054844-1745630588.png) 加密格式: > $1 = MD5 hashing algo ......
密文 密码 格式 shadow Linux

Linux DNS配置手册

Linux系统-部署-运维系列导航 关于DNS生效优先级 Linux系统中,域名解析相关的配置存在多个地方,经常使用的包括 1.本地hosts文件,/etc/hosts,指定将域名解析到特定IP 配置格式 ip 域名1 域名2 ... 2.dns配置文件,/etc/resolv.conf,指定dns ......
手册 Linux DNS

Linux系统ORACLE重启命令

如下: 一、 在Linux下重启Oracle数据库及监听器: .以oracle身份登录数据库,命令:su -oracle .进入Sqlplus控制台,命令:sqlplus /nolog .以系统管理员登录,命令:connect / as sysdba .启动数据库,命令:startup 如果是关闭数 ......
命令 ORACLE 系统 Linux

Linux文件扩展名:

Linux文件扩展名:基本上, Linux的文件是没有所谓的“扩展名”的, 一个Linux文件能不能被执行, 与他的第一栏的十个属性有关, 与文件名根本一点关系也没有。 这个观念跟Windows的情况不相同! 在Windows下面, 能被执行的文件扩展名通常是 .com.exe .bat等等, 而在 ......
扩展名 文件 Linux

Linux系统-部署-运维系列导航

PS:此为大纲,具体内容持续完善中 系统环境 Linux软件环境初始化(CentOS) Linux DNS配置手册 LinuxWindows常用 Linux分区、LVM、文件系统(CentOS 7) Linux NTP时钟同步 Linux开发小工具 Python-3.10.5学习笔记 部署运维 组件 ......
系统 Linux

从零做软件开发项目系列之十——项目运维

项目结项后的运维阶段是确保软件持续稳定运行、修复问题、满足用户需求的关键时期。在这个阶段,需要建立有效的维护制度,关注各种问题,并采取相应措施来保障系统的可靠性和可持续性。 ......
项目 软件开发 软件

温室气体数据记录软件

温室气体数据记录软件用于记录温室气体分析仪、冷阱系统、阀箱以及采样单元数据的获取及记录。其软件界面如下: ![](https://img2023.cnblogs.com/blog/564295/202309/564295-20230901083812099-30166205.png) 在软件操作几面 ......
温室 气体 数据 软件

Linux 的cp命令

Linux 的cp命令 功能: 复制文件或目录说明: cp指令用于复制文件或目录,如同时指定两个以上的文件或目录,且最后的目的地是一个已经存在的目录,则它会把前面指定的所有文件或目录复制到此目录中。若同时指定多个文件或目录,而最后的目的地并非一个已存在的目录,则会出现错误信息参数: -a 或 --a ......
命令 Linux

Linux解压/压缩.tar .tgz .tar.gz .tar.Z等文件

.tar解包:tar xvf FileName.tar打包:tar cvf FileName.tar DirName(注:tar是打包,不是压缩!) .gz解压1:gunzip FileName.gz解压2:gzip -d FileName.gz压缩:gzip FileName.tar.gz 和 . ......
tar 文件 Linux tgz gz

linux 安装typora

在Linux终端中执行下列代码 # or run: # sudo apt-key adv --keyserver keyserver.ubuntu.com --recv-keys BA300B7755AFCFAE wget -qO - https://typoraio.cn/linux/public ......
typora linux

linux学习链接

哔哩哔哩https://www.bilibili.com/video/BV1mW411i7Qf?from=search&seid=4587862116724074639&spm_id_from=333.337.0.0 https://study.163.com/course/courseLearn. ......
链接 linux

100个常用的linux 命令与介绍

这些是一些常见的 Linux 命令,用于处理文件、进程、网络、用户、系统管理等各种任务。根据你的需要,你可能会经常使用其中一些命令来管理和操作你的 Linux 系统。每个命令都有更多的选项和用法,你可以通过在终端中运行 man 命令名 来查看命令的详细帮助文档。 ......
命令 常用 linux 100

linux

Linux 从零开始学习笔记 从零开始学习Linux,记录笔记,担心自己以后会忘,也供大家茶余饭后,闲来无事看看,自己的理解只能到这,能力有限。也希望大家可以指出我的错误,让我可以有一点点进步,以后会一直更新,同时也希望大家可以收藏,点赞加关注三连一下,大家有什么问题或者我的错误也可以在评论里留下来 ......
linux

linux下安装python

``` 1)前往用户根目录 >: cd ~ 2)下载 或 上传 Python3.6.7 # 服务器终端 >: wget https://www.python.org/ftp/python/3.6.7/Python-3.6.7.tar.xz # 本地终端,给服务器上传 >: scp -r 本地Pyth ......
python linux

新一代AI换脸和人脸增强软件及使用教程!facefusion

又有新东西咯! ​ 编辑切换为居中 添加图片注释,不超过 140 字(可选) roop停更了,核心开发者独立发布了一个项目,就是这个叫facefusion的项目。官方介绍为下一代的人脸交换和增强软件。 这是官方预览图,又红又紫,确实有点fusion的感觉。 ​ 编辑切换为居中 添加图片注释,不超过 ......
人脸 facefusion 新一代 教程 软件

软件架构师考试其实很轻松

首先这是一份记录稿,因为成绩还没出,不能算是成功经验,但的确是备考经验。 我的态度,如果你想以考促学,这将是一个非常不错的出发点,系统架构师教程它是有知识体系的,不是零散的知识点,对锻炼一个人的高层次架构思维助益颇多,当然这些只有在你认真学习过后才能体会的到。如果你仅仅是把它当作一次考试,也是值得的 ......
架构 软件

linux环境使用docker安装mongodb

拉取镜像 docker pull mongo:4.4.4 查看镜像 docker images 镜像安装并启动 docker run -itd --name mongo -p 27017:27017 mongo --auth 如果出现如下错误 请使用 docker exec -it mongo mo ......
mongodb 环境 docker linux

linux 磁盘管理常用操作

理论看前一篇 动态扩展: vgs 查看vg lvextend -L +10G /dev/mapper/lv-name 其中lv-name可以通过df -Th查看 lvs 查看lv resize2fs /dev/mapper/lv-name 设置文件系统 xfs_growfs /dev/mapper/ ......
磁盘 常用 linux

Linux及vim使用

# 课程:Linux命令和vim使用 目的:linux常用命令与vim的使用可以很大程度上加速我们开发效率 ## 知识点一:常用命令 ### 1、 命令行 ``` ls :查看当前目录下的文件和目录(我能看到什么) pwd :查看当前路径(我在哪) whoami :当前用户(我是谁) cd :跳转路 ......
Linux vim

linux环境使用docker安装redis

拉取指定版本的镜像 docker pull redis:5.0.3 查看镜像 docker images 安装redis docker run --name my-redis-container -d -p 6379:6379 redis 以上表示redis已经启动,使用了6379端口号 下面来设置 ......
环境 docker linux redis

18 Linux 阻塞和非阻塞 IO 实验

一、阻塞和非阻塞 IO 1. 阻塞和非阻塞简介 这里的 IO 指 Input/Output(输入/输出),是应用程序对驱动设备的输入/输出操作。当应用程序对设备驱动进行操作的时候,如果不能获取到设备资源,那么阻塞式 IO 就会将对应应用程序对应的线程挂起,直到设备资源可以获取为止。非阻塞式 IO,应 ......
Linux 18 IO

linux发行版上软件包的安装与卸载

http://www.taodudu.cc/news/show-5916363.html?action=onClick https://www.lxlinux.net/4640.html ......
软件包 linux 软件

Linux-批量telnet测试端口连通性脚本

1、创建sh脚本vim telnet_batch.sh#!/bin/bash#zkm 2023-08-31check_telnet(){for ip_port in $(cat ip_info|grep -v '^#')doCHECK_PORT=$(echo $ip_port|awk -F: '{p ......
端口 脚本 telnet Linux

Linux中Tomcat介绍及安装

一、什么是Tomcat 1.1 tomcat历史和介绍 Tomcat服务器是一个免费的开放源代码的Web应用服务器,属于轻量级应用服务器,在中小型系统和并发访问用户不是很多的场合下被普遍使用,Tomcat具有处理HTML页面的功能,它还是一个Servlet和JSP容器 起始于SUN公司的一个Serv ......
Tomcat Linux

linux软连接

语法: ln -s /usr/local/mysql/bin/mysql /usr/bin 软连接。软链接文件有类似于Windows的快捷方式。它实际上是一个特殊的文件。在符号连接中,文件实际上是一个文本文件,其中包含的有另一文件的位置信息。 【硬连接】硬连接指通过索引节点来进行连接。在Linux的 ......
linux